Veg Sandwich Finalists
Vegetarian sandwich recipes are finalists in Jif’s “Most Creative Peanut Butter Sandwich Contest.”
March 1, 2010
Today, Jif announced the five finalists in its seventh-annual “Most Creative Peanut Butter Sandwich Contest,” for kids, and two of the sandwiches are vegetarian. The “Peanutty Cristo Breakfast Sandwich” was submitted by an 11-year-old from Massachusetts, and the “Peanut Butter and Banana Quesadilla” by a nine-year-old from Wisconsin. The other three competing entries call for chicken, but both vegetarian recipes can easily be veganized by substituting dairy-free alternatives. A vegan-friendly “Veggie Sloppy/Sweet Joe” sandwich, submitted by a 10-year-old vegetarian from Illinois, was a top 12 finalist after the first round of voting ended two weeks ago, but did not make it into the top five.
